예제 #1
0
        public frmDocumentos(int _idDocument, bool _readOnly)
        {
            InitializeComponent();
            ReadOnly = _readOnly;
            dgvDatos.DisplayLayout.Override.AllowAddNew = Infragistics.Win.UltraWinGrid.AllowAddNew.TemplateOnBottom;
            //  I  N  I  C  I  A  L  I  Z  A  R
            //dgvDatos.DataSource = _details;
            IdDocument          = _idDocument;
            config              = new Configuracion.SDK_Configuracion_Document(IdDocument, this);
            config.ModeDocument = "Edit";
            config.StartEmpty();
            IVA = config.IVA1;
            this.AccessibleDescription = "SDK " + this.Text;
            this.btnCrear.Text         = "Actualizar";
            this.CleanScreen();

            txtCardCode.ReadOnly = false;
            txtCardCode.Enabled  = true;

            txtCardName.ReadOnly = false;
            txtCardName.Enabled  = true;

            txtFolio.BackColor     = Color.FromName("Info");
            txtCardCode.BackColor  = Color.FromName("Info");
            txtCardName.BackColor  = Color.FromName("Info");
            txtNumAtCard.BackColor = Color.FromName("Info");

            cerrarStripButton.Enabled            = true;
            nuevoToolStripButton.Enabled         = false;
            cerrarLíneaToolStripMenuItem.Enabled = true;
        }
예제 #2
0
 public frmDocumentos(DataTable _details, int _idDocument, string _cardCode)
 {
     InitializeComponent();
     dgvDatos.DisplayLayout.Override.AllowAddNew = Infragistics.Win.UltraWinGrid.AllowAddNew.TemplateOnBottom;
     //  I  N  I  C  I  A  L  I  Z  A  R
     IdDocument          = _idDocument;
     config              = new Configuracion.SDK_Configuracion_Document(IdDocument, this);
     config.ModeDocument = "New";
     config.StartFill(IdDocument, _details, _cardCode);
     IVA      = config.IVA1;
     VatGroup = config.VatGroup;
     this.AccessibleDescription   = "SDK " + this.Text;
     this.btnCrear.Text           = "Crear";
     nuevoToolStripButton.Enabled = false;
 }
예제 #3
0
        public frmDocumentos(int _idDocument, decimal _DocKey, int _ObjType, decimal _WtmCode, decimal _WddCode)
        {
            InitializeComponent();
            typeDocument = "Borrador";
            DocumentSAP  = new SDK_SAP.Clases.Document();
            dgvDatos.DisplayLayout.Override.AllowAddNew = Infragistics.Win.UltraWinGrid.AllowAddNew.TemplateOnBottom;
            //  I  N  I  C  I  A  L  I  Z  A  R
            IdDocument          = _idDocument;
            config              = new SDK.Configuracion.SDK_Configuracion_Document(IdDocument, this);
            config.ModeDocument = "New";
            config.StartEmpty();
            IVA = config.IVA1;
            this.AccessibleDescription = "SDK " + this.Text;

            txtFolio.Text = _DocKey.ToString();
            DocKey        = _DocKey;
            ObjType       = _ObjType;
            WtmCode       = _WtmCode;
            WddCode       = _WddCode;
        }